In India, the real estate sector has always been a promising avenue for investment, offering diverse opportunities to grow your wealth. Among the various types of real estate investments, multi-family properties have garnered significant attention. Investing in multi-family properties, such as apartment buildings or housing complexes, is increasingly seen as a strategic move towards achieving financial independence.
Why Invest in Multi-Family Properties?

1. Steady Rental Income
One of the primary reasons investors in cities like Mumbai, Bengaluru, and Hyderabad are turning towards multi-family properties is the prospect of a consistent rental income. Unlike single-family homes where your income relies on a single tenant, multi-family properties have multiple tenants, reducing the risk of complete vacancy. This diversified tenant base ensures a steady cash flow, contributing to financial stability and independence over time.
2. Economies of Scale
Investing in multi-family properties provides economies of scale that aren't typically achievable with single-family homes. When managing properties in urban regions such as Delhi NCR or Chennai, you’ll find that operation costs per unit decrease as the number of apartments or homes increases. Shared facilities like security, gardens, and maintenance staff also lower costs when allocated across multiple units. These efficiencies can lead to higher profit margins, providing a more substantial return on investment.
3. Appreciation of Property Value
Indian cities are experiencing rapid urbanization and population growth. With this surge comes an increase in demand for rental housing. Multi-family properties in prime locations such as Pune or Kolkata tend to appreciate faster due to high demand, allowing investors to build equity more quickly. As property values go up, so does your investment's worth, providing a buffer against inflation and adding to your financial independence.
4. Tax Benefits
Investing in multi-family properties comes with a suite of tax benefits. In India, property owners can claim deductions for expenses like loan interest, property taxes, and maintenance costs. These allowances can significantly reduce taxable income, helping you keep more of your rental profits. Given the government's initiatives to promote affordable housing, there might also be benefits under specific schemes, which further enhance financial prospects.
Challenges to Consider
Like any investment, multi-family properties come with challenges. Being aware of these can help you make informed decisions.
1. Management Complexity
Managing a multi-family property is more complex compared to a single-family home. The responsibility increases with more tenants, requiring efficient property management. Finding a trustworthy property management team is crucial, especially in bustling cities like Ahmedabad or Jaipur, where tenant turnover can be high.
2. Higher Upfront Costs
Acquiring a multi-family property demands a significant upfront investment. Whether you’re eyeing a burgeoning area like Kochi or Tier II cities witnessing growth, the initial costs can be substantial. However, with careful planning and financial structuring, including opting for competitive home loan rates, this investment can yield substantial long-term benefits.
3. Regulatory Challenges
Navigating through local zoning laws and regulations is essential. Indian cities have diverse regulations that can affect property investment strategies. Engaging with local real estate experts and staying informed about regulatory updates ensures compliance and smooth operation.
Steps to Get Started
1. Conduct Thorough Research
Research is key. Study the local real estate market trends in your chosen city. Whether it’s a metro like Mumbai or an emerging hub like Bhubaneswar, understanding market dynamics helps identify promising investment opportunities.
2. Evaluate Financial Readiness
Assess your financial situation. Calculate potential returns and affordability, keeping in mind that multi-family investments often require a robust financial approach. Aligning these with your long-term financial goals, such as achieving financial independence, will guide your decision-making process.
3. Engage with Professionals
Engage with real estate professionals who understand the landscape of Indian cities. From legal advisors to estate agents, having professionals by your side can provide valuable insights and facilitate a smoother investment experience.
